❓ The Problem
❌ Mesh/vertex UI outlines shimmer, alias and disappear the moment they get thin ❌ Small sizes, high-DPI screens and animated scaling make them fall apart ❌ Rounded corners look faceted unless you crank the segment count
✅ The Solution
An SDF (signed-distance-field) outline: the edge is computed per-pixel from a distance field instead of built from geometry, so it stays crisp and consistent at any resolution — no flicker, no dropouts, smooth corners. A classic mesh-ring mode is included for when you want it.
⚡ Performance
One quad, one lightweight fragment shader, premultiplied-alpha blending — allocation-free in SDF mode. It's a UI graphic, and it costs like one. Works in any pipeline with no render feature or setup.

⚠️ Good to know
• The outline shape is a rounded rectangle — perfect for panels, buttons, cards and highlights, not arbitrary sprite silhouettes • SDF mode renders through its own included shader (registered automatically, so builds are covered)
